Sustainable fashion in Portugal

Portugal is one of the few countries in Europe that still has the whole textile chain (spinning, weaving, dyeing, making up) mostly in the north, mostly around Porto and the Ave valley. That industrial base attracts foreign sustainable brands and gives domestic ones room to produce locally.

ISTO. makes everyday clothing in Lisbon with published costs and factory names. SENSIHEMP works with regenerative hemp in Póvoa de Varzim. Burel Factory weaves Serra da Estrela wool in Manteigas, Tinctorium dyes with plants near Lisbon, and Vintage for a Cause and Valérius 360 work from textile waste in Porto and Barcelos.
